To obtain a Danish chauffeur's license, applicants must fulfill certain eligibility criteria. These consist of:
Age: The minimum age differs by classification:
Category A: 18 yearsCategory B: 18 yearsClassification C: 21 years (with a valid B license)Category D: 24 years (with a valid B license)
Residency: Applicants must be citizens of Denmark or have been living in Denmark for a minimum duration, generally at least 6 months.

Knowledge Test: Before practicing driving, applicants must pass a theoretical knowledge test that covers Danish traffic regulations, roadway indications, and safe driving practices.
Driving Lessons: Practical driving lessons with a licensed trainer are mandatory, with a minimum number of lessons required.
Driving Test: A practical driving test must be passed, showing the applicant's capability to handle the lorry securely.

FAQsWhat if I currently have a driver's license from another country?
If you hold a legitimate chauffeur's license from another EU nation, you might have the ability to exchange it for a Danish license without taking the tests. If it's from a non-EU nation, you might require to undergo the full process.
For how long does it take to get a chauffeur's license in Denmark?
The timeline can vary, typically ranging from a few months to a year depending upon the individual's speed in completing driving lessons and tests.
Can I drive in Denmark with a foreign motorist's license?
Yes, you can drive in Denmark using your foreign driver's license for a restricted time (normally up to six months), but you will need to obtain a regional license if you mean to remain longer.
Is it mandatory to take driving lessons from a driving school?
Yes, taking driving lessons from an authorized driving school is a necessary requirement as part of the training to ensure safety and proficiency.
What happens if I fail the driving test?
If you stop working the useful driving test, you can retake it after a waiting duration, which is typically two weeks. Preparation through extra lessons is recommended before the retake.
